Transaction e66d362e1f5216bce0153962eaec55738f56e36b4581bf34a3b3003109f381d9
1 Input
1 Output
-
e66d362e1f5216bce0153962eaec55738f56e36b4581bf34a3b3003109f381d9:0
- value
- 73868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8334ad69d40b50a694b0dd5df92f4742bfd1fc38 OP_EQUAL
- address
- 3DemYmDbnWxHvZu5GN6Nh8nEkuAok55NTC